Intermediate (A1)
Thai Pads
Round 1: Free work; 1K-10K
Round 2: In between calling combinations, Pad holder can make a hook with the striking surface of the thai pad. Striker covers against the hook on their rear side and counters with a lead hook/cross/lead round kick. Striker covers against the hook on their lead side and counters with a cross/lead hook/rear round kick.
Round 3: Striker covers against hook to the body on their rear side and counters with a rear uppercut/lead hook/rear kick. Striker covers against hook to the body on their lead side and counters with a lead uppercut/cross/lead kick.

Advanced (A1)
Thai Pads
Round 1: Free work, all combinations including kicks, elbows, and knees. Add a Jab/Cross after every combination with a kick. Emphasize Striker returning back to a good stance and balanced base after the kick in order to launch Jab/Cross as quickly as possible.
Round 2: Free work, all combinations, but now Striker ends each combo with a FKVT (Striker's choice as to lead/rear leg), emphasizing balance and finding range.
Round 3: After calling combo, pad holder can hold for the Jab/Cross OR the FKVT. Striker must find balance as quickly as possible and make necessary adjustment for range of available target.

Beginner (A1)
Movement – Shadow boxing w/o punches or kicks
Basic Takedown Defense (changing height, moving feet)
Choke from Behind
Drill: A/B drill. Group A attacks, group B defends. Defenders in passive stance, eyes closed. Attackers choke from behind. During defense, attacks should try to grab at defender’s legs or get under the control arm to take defender down. Safety Note: Attackers should NOT actually perform the takedown unless ample space is available and everyone knows how to fall break safely. Simply exposing the opportunity for the takedown is sufficient.

DRILL - FINAL: Role Flow
Grps of 4 (A, B, C, D) in a line, spread out. A starts of as attacker, B neutral eyes closed, C and D lying on ground/side. A attacks B with Side Headlock. B defends and moves to attack C with Ground Headlock Forward, while A stands neutral, eyes closed. After defending, C moves on to attack D with Ground Headlock Backward, B stays on ground. After defense, C stays on ground, D runs down to attack A, and flow resumes.
